(1)A credit union may display at its registered office, but only at that office, an interim revenue account or balance sheet which has not been audited, provided that—
(a)the latest audited revenue account and balance sheet are displayed side by side with the interim revenue account or balance sheet; and
(b)the interim revenue account or balance sheet so displayed is marked in clearly legible characters and in a prominent position with the words " UNAUDITED REVENUE ACCOUNT" or, as the case may be, " UNAUDITED BALANCE SHEET ".
(2)Paragraphs (a) and (b) of subsection (5) of section 3 of the [1968 c. 55.] Friendly and Industrial and Provident Societies Act 1968 (requirements as to audit) shall not apply in relation to any such interim revenue account or balance sheet as is referred to in subsection (1) above and section 39(1) of the 1965 Act (annual returns) shall not apply to any such interim balance sheet
